YOUNG shale expo is 10 days away

The Youngstown/ Warren Regional Chamber’s first-of-its-kind Utica Shale conference and trade show is quickly approaching. The Youngstown Ohio Utica & Natural Gas business-to-business conference, scheduled from 10 a.m. to 7:30 p.m. Nov. 30 at the Covelli Centre, will feature national and local companies and their products and expertise regarding the Utica and Marcellus Shale supply chain.
